The Evolution of Mobile Communication

1. Analog Cellular Phones

In the late 20th century, the first generation (1G) of mobile communication technology was introduced. Analog cellular phones, such as the Motorola DynaTAC 8000X, were large, heavy, and had limited battery life. However, they marked the beginning of mobile communication, enabling people to make calls on the go.

2. Digital Cellular Phones

The introduction of the second generation (2G) of mobile communication technology in the mid-1990s brought significant improvements to mobile communication. Digital cellular phones, such as the Nokia 3310, offered better voice quality, longer battery life, and the ability to send text messages. The 2G era also saw the birth of mobile internet, allowing users to access the internet on their phones.

3. 3G and 4G Technology

The third generation (3G) and fourth generation (4G) of mobile communication technology further improved the speed and capabilities of mobile communication. 3G technology, introduced in the early 2000s, enabled faster data speeds, which allowed for more advanced mobile applications and services. 4G technology, which became widely available in the late 2010s, provided even faster data speeds, lower latency, and better network coverage.

4. 5G Technology

The fifth generation (5G) of mobile communication technology, which is currently being rolled out globally, promises to revolutionize the mobile communication landscape once again. With its ultra-fast speeds, low latency, and massive machine-type communication capabilities, 5G is expected to enable new applications and services, such as autonomous vehicles, smart cities, and advanced healthcare.

The Potential Future of Mobile Communication

1. 6G Technology

While 5G technology is still being rolled out, researchers and engineers are already working on the next generation of mobile communication technology, known as 6G. 6G is expected to offer even faster speeds, lower latency, and more advanced capabilities, such as terahertz communication and advanced artificial intelligence integration.

2. Internet of Things (IoT)

The Internet of Things (IoT) is another significant area of development in mobile communication. With the increasing number of connected devices, mobile communication will play a crucial role in enabling seamless communication between these devices. This will lead to the development of smart homes, smart cities, and other advanced applications.

3. Enhanced Security and Privacy

As mobile communication becomes more integrated into our lives, the importance of security and privacy will also increase. Future mobile communication technologies will need to address these concerns, ensuring that users' data is protected and their privacy is maintained.
